How 401(k) Plans Work
A 401(k) is a retirement savings plan sponsored by an employer. It lets workers save and invest a portion of their paychecks before taxes are deducted. Taxes are not paid on the money until it is withdrawn from the account.
With a 401(k), employees can choose to have a portion of their paycheck automatically deposited into their 401(k) account. The funds are then invested according to the employee’s instructions.
Most 401(k) plans offer a variety of investment options, including stocks, bonds, and mutual funds. Some plans also offer employer matching contributions, which can help employees save even more for retirement.

What happens to 401k when you quit?
When you change jobs, it may be tempting to withdraw all the money in your 401(k) plan. However, this is usually a bad financial decision. Withdrawals from 401(k)s before age 55 are usually subject to income tax and a 10% early withdrawal penalty, which can easily eliminate a large part of your savings.

Can you withdraw from 401k?
Yes, you can withdraw from your 401k, but there may be consequences depending on the amount you withdraw and your age. If you withdraw money from your 401k before you reach the age of 59 1/2, you may be subject to an early withdrawal penalty. Additionally, the money you withdraw will be subject to income tax. How much I should put in my 401k?
Most retirement experts recommend contributing 10-15% of your income towards your 401(k) each year. The maximum contribution limit for individuals in 2021 is $19,500, or $26,000 if you are 50 or older. In 2022, the maximum contribution limit will be $20,500, or $27,000 if you are 50 or older.

Which real estate investing is best?
There are a number of different ways to invest in real estate,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Some of the most popular methods include fix-and-flip investing, rental property investing, and REITs.
Fix-and-flip investing involves purchasing a property, making any necessary repairs or renovations, and then selling it for a profit. This can be a quick and profitable way to invest in real estate, but it does require a significant amount of time and effort.
Rental property investing involves purchasing a property and then renting it out to tenants. This can be a great way to generate passive income, but it does require a significant amount of upfront capital.
REITs offer investors the potential for both capital appreciation and stable, rent-yielding cash flows. Approximately 90% of REIT earnings are distributed to unit-holders.
